How to fill out air abrasives 101

How to fill out air abrasives 101?
01
Start by gathering all necessary materials and equipment required for air abrasives. This typically includes an air compressor, abrasive material, a blasting gun, protective wear, and a workpiece to be treated.
02
Connect the air compressor to the blasting gun using the appropriate hoses and fittings. Ensure that all connections are secure to prevent any leaks.
03
Use the blasting gun's control panel to adjust the air pressure and abrasive flow rate according to the specifications recommended for the specific application or surface treatment desired.
04
Load the abrasive material into the blasting gun's reservoir or hopper. Make sure to choose the appropriate abrasive material for the job, as different materials are suited for different purposes.
05
Put on the necessary protective wear, such as gloves, safety glasses, and a respirator, to ensure personal safety during the air abrasives process.
06
Position the blasting gun at a suitable distance from the workpiece and begin spraying the abrasive material onto the desired area. Ensure that the gun is constantly moving to avoid over-blasting or causing any uneven surface finishes.
07
Continue blasting until the desired surface treatment is achieved. Take breaks periodically to inspect the workpiece and make any necessary adjustments to the air pressure or abrasive flow rate.
08
Once the air abrasives process is complete, disconnect the air compressor and clean the blasting gun and hoses thoroughly to remove any remaining abrasive material.
